We're seeking a dedicated Clinical Psychologist to join RTN Mental Health Solutions. This fully remote role offers the opportunity to play a key part in the diagnostic journey for children, young people, and adults with suspected autism and ADHD. You'll work as part of a multidisciplinary team, delivering comprehensive assessments, clinical formulations, and psychological insight.

We welcome applications from Clinical Psychologists at different stages of their career, including newly qualified practitioners. Your skills and perspective will help shape the future of neurodevelopmental services at RTN.

Key Responsibilities
  • Conduct comprehensive neurodevelopmental assessments for children, young people, and adults with suspected autism and/or ADHD.
  • Administer and interpret gold-standard diagnostic tools, including ADOS-2 and ADI-R.
  • Develop clear summary formulations that integrate developmental history, observations, and assessment data to support diagnostic decisions.
  • Produce high-quality, person-centred diagnostic reports that meet clinical, professional, and regulatory standards.
  • Maintain accurate, confidential clinical records in line with HCPC, GDPR, and RTN policies.
  • Engage actively in multidisciplinary team discussions, contributing to holistic case understanding and treatment planning.
  • Collaborate with psychiatrists, speech and language therapists, occupational therapists, and other professionals to ensure a joined-up approach to care.
  • Offer expert advice and consultation on neurodevelopmental conditions to colleagues and partner professionals.
  • Take part in service development initiatives, including audits, pathway design, and quality improvement.
